Finance Review Summary — Hedging Decision

Reviewed Q3 exposure on the Velran crown following the Osterfeld expansion. Forward contracts locked for 70% of projected receivables; remainder floats per Tavrin's model. Cost of carry acceptable; downside capped at tolerance threshold. No objections from treasury. Decision stands through year-end unless volatility doubles. The strategic rationale behind the partial hedge is noted below.

confidential, bahop-hahif: Only 3 of the 140 pilot accounts renewed Oliath, so a churn review is set for July 15.

## Session Handling: Dedup Sweep

Customer record deduplication now runs inside the session layer. On login, Kestrelbase merges duplicate profiles keyed by normalized identity hash; surviving record keeps the oldest session history. Merges are irreversible — gate releases on the dedup dry-run report. Sweep jobs hit the merge API every six hours. The sweep authenticates with the bearer token below.

session JWT of yawep-yawep = eyJhbGciOiJIUzI1NiIsInR5cCI6IkpXVCJ9.eyJzdWIiOiI3pWF3_In0.aXYsHiog

**Building access: bike cage and parking gates.** New starters at Brindlecote Yard can use the bike cage off the south alley and the parking gates on Welfern Road. Your permanent fob usually arrives within your first week; until then, access runs on a rotating keypad code. Check in at reception on your first morning to confirm your details. Enter the cage and gates with the code below.

badge for bajop-hahip: bdg-YL-7

**Handover — Nightwork, Dunmoor server room**

To the Fennick Systems contractor taking over from me: after-hours entry is through the loading bay, not the lobby, and the alarm must be disarmed within sixty seconds of the door opening. Sign the red logbook on the shelf inside. The keypad beside the inner door takes the code below.

turnstile pass: bdg-QZV-3